Five to see live

USA TODAY, May, 2008

The road will be jammed with tour buses this summer as pop icons, country favorites, hip-hop acts and rock stars of every stripe come to a venue near you.

The Police are still the biggest name out there, but Celine Dion is touring again after a five-year Vegas stint. Other top acts: Dave Matthews Band, Kenny Chesney, Neil Diamond and Coldplay, which is expected to announce a slate of dates.

If you prefer one-stop shopping, there are more fests than ever, most with major headliners.

At a time when a tank of gas costs as much as a concert ticket, these dollar-stretching events with dozens of bands have become a preferred way to see live music.
